[picappgallerysingle id="98237"]Everyone has different goals, and those with an earned graduate degree are no different in that sense. They want as much personal freedom as possible while earning a living at something that is close to what they studied in graduate school. Today, it is possible to have an enormous amount of personal freedom while teaching the very subject you studied in order to earn your master’s degree or Ph.D., and the vehicle that will make this happy combination arrive is online adjunct faculty jobs. The career arc offered by the maturation of distance education technology over the last ten years is quite attractive to those who have the appropriate academic credentials and the technical ability to constantly engage different digital interfaces that represent the college campus online.
New and returning college students are taking to online college courses as they earn an online accounting degree, an online business administration degree or an online psychology degree because attending class online is simply much more efficient than traveling by personal vehicle to a distant traditional college campus at odd hours of the day or night. What is advantageous to online adjunct instructors with online adjunct jobs is that every online class needs an online teacher, and as more and more colleges and universities develop and offer their students online bachelor degree programs and online master’s degree programs the need for online college teachers grows in proportional dimensions.
Teaching online for online degree programs is not always easy because it requires attention to detail and a willingness to lean new technology, but the personal freedom acquired by teaching multiple online classes and the professional scalability that results from easily acquiring more online university jobs or declining offered online teaching jobs openings is not to be dismissed out of hand. For example, what traditional academic job or corporate position can be accomplished without geographic boundaries? It is possible to teach college students earning online accredited degrees from a inexpensive laptop computer while seated in a hotel lobby in Mexico City or from a houseboat anchored off the bay of San Francisco. Further, since all online teaching activity takes place on the Internet, it is possible to search for and apply to community college and for-profit schools without having to once set foot on the physical campuses of these post-secondary academic institutions. The duties required of an online adjunct instructor can be successfully accomplished from the geographic location chosen by the online adjunct.
Distance education is also growing in popularity with college administrators. When compared to the expense of maintain large physical college campuses populated with older, less energy efficient buildings, online college degree programs seem a real bargain from an economic perspective. New and returning college students, many of which are non-traditional students with time-consuming family and employment commitments, prefer to attend online college courses because they can be entered at any time of the day or night from any location. The enthusiasm of both of these groups means that here will be more and more online adjunct faculty jobs as time goes on and the demand for online degrees increases beyond what is offered today.
